1990 Audi Coupe vs. 2005 BMW X5

To start off, 2005 BMW X5 is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1990 Audi Coupe.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1990 Audi Coupe would be higher. At 2,926 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 BMW X5 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1990 Audi Coupe (217 HP @ 5900 RPM) has 2 more horse power than 2005 BMW X5. (215 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1990 Audi Coupe should accelerate faster than 2005 BMW X5.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 BMW X5 weights approximately 750 kg more than 1990 Audi Coupe.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 BMW X5 (520 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 205 more torque (in Nm) than 1990 Audi Coupe. (315 Nm @ 2100 RPM). This means 2005 BMW X5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1990 Audi Coupe.
